03.02.2017 · Problem solving is quite effective, through checking the facts, realizing assumptions, knowing what needs to happen for the emotion and situation to change, brainstorming ideas, and doing pros and cons of the best ideas from that list. It may seem like a lot, and it does take some time, but it’s exceptionally effective. In the previous two videos (4b, 4c) you learned the emotion regulation skills check the facts and opposite action.21.02.2017 · Options for Solving Any Problem When life presents you with problems, what are your options? 1. Solve the Problem Change the situation . . . or avoid, leave, or get out of the situation for good. 2. Feel Better about the Problem Change (or regulate) your emotional response to the problem. 3. Tolerate the Problem […]
